Hello, SSDs really have a very fast read and write speed. To truly appreciate their performance, they need to be put to the test with very large volumes of processing, (such as video processing, encoding, frequently moving files of several hundred gigabytes...) otherwise, it won't be really noticeable.

Then, the benefit of having a good SSD is peace of mind. Reliability to keep our important files safe and to use intensively if needed, so in this regard, I would personally recommend Samsung or Crucial, both of which are very good brands! Of course, there are others that are also recognized as very reliable.
